Come join our team! Mobius is seeking a Cyber Security Engineer/Information Systems Security Officer (ISSO).
In this role you will be part of a team providing Systems Engineering Technical Assistance to the Ground-based Midcourse Dense (GMD) Product Office under the Teams-Next Missile Defense Systems Engineering (TN-MDSE) contract managed by the Missile Defense Agency. This position is in Huntsville , AL.
Duties of a Cyber Security Engineer/ISSO may include:
- Serve as a member of the cybersecurity team, developing System Security Plans (SSPs), Interim Authority to Test (IATT), Authority to Connect (ATC) and, Authority to Operate (ATO) packages.
- Perform technical work utilizing the Risk Management Framework (RMF) process including analyzing and solving Information Assurance (IA)-related technical problems.
- Ensure that system security artifacts are developed, reviewed, and updated as needed.
- Confirm all RMF requirements are properly addressed and required artifacts are loaded and managed within Enterprise Mission Assurance Support Service (eMASS).
- Ability to analyze complex problems, identify root causes, and develop actionable recommendations with effective solutions.
- Interface with other cyber teams to review RMF Contract Data Requirements Lists (CDRLs) and ensure timely delivery of CDRL artifacts, while providing feedback to ensure the sufficiency and quality of cyber artifacts.
- Periodically conduct a review of each system’s audits and monitors corrective actions until all actions are closed.
- Perform vulnerability/risk analysis of systems using expertise in relevant information systems security.
- Track and monitor Plan of Action and Milestones (POA&Ms).
- Conduct reviews of cybersecurity artifacts and technical briefings and work with customer to resolve any findings.
- Ensure that identified security controls are implemented and operating as intended through all phases of the lifecycle.
- Track deliverables (i.e., artifacts, schedules, metrics).
